## Log Sampling — Chirpkit Ingest Service

Chirpkit emits roughly 40k log lines per minute under normal load, so we sample aggressively before shipping to the Lanternview aggregator. Plugin authors: your plugin inherits the host sampling rate unless you register an override in `sampling.toml`, and overrides above 10% require approval from the platform team. To test sampling behavior locally, you need the aggregator write credential, which the sampler reads from your .env. Add it on this line:

sealed setting: LEDGER_TOKEN13=5d842615a26d7

## Authentication

The Emberline firmware update channel requires every publish and promote call to be authenticated against the internal Channelgate service. Keys are scoped per environment; the one documented here grants write access to the staging channel only, and it must never be used to push builds toward production devices. Rotate it whenever a maintainer leaves the project, and record the rotation date in the changelog. For local development and CI dry runs, use the staging key shown below.

gateway credential: kto23_LX9A4ys6i4nzHtpOLNLodKK

## Service Accounts — StormFan Alert Fan-Out

The fan-out worker authenticates to the internal dispatch tier using the svc-stormfan account. Rotate quarterly; scopes are limited to publish-only on alert topics. If deliveries stall during your shift, verify the worker is using the current credential, reproduced below for reference.

API key for kaweg-hahif: kto4_rAjZ